About Daniel G. Mead

Daniel G. Mead is a scholar working on Parasitology, Infectious Diseases and Ecology, Evolution, Behavior and Systematics, having authored 13 papers that have together received 572 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Viral Infections and Vectors (11 papers), Vector-borne infectious diseases (8 papers) and Mosquito-borne diseases and control (6 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Parasitology (523 citations), Infectious Diseases (479 citations) and Insect Science (130 citations). Daniel G. Mead has collaborated with scholars based in United States and Canada. Frequent co-authors include Michael J. Yabsley, D. W. Watson, Jeffrey Engel, William L. Nicholson, Charles S. Apperson, William R. Davidson, Vivien G. Dugan, Elizabeth W. Howerth, Ulrike G. Munderloh and Cynthia M. Tate.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Clinical Microbiology, Emerging infectious diseases and American Journal of Tropical Medicine and Hygiene.
